GNOME Bugzilla – Bug 675343
status menu doesn't affect Empathy ICQ status
Last modified: 2018-05-22 15:30:32 UTC
Originally reported at: https://bugs.launchpad.net/ubuntu/+source/empathy/+bug/990713 Gnome-shell user (aka status menu) menu doesn't change ICQ status
Does it work with Empathy's presence chooser?
I can choose icq status from Empathy's contact list, but not gnome-shell user menu or ubuntu's indicator messages menu. This behavior for icq protocol, with Gtalk and Jabber works ok.
Interesting. Could you please: - Make sure your icq account is connected - dbus-monitor > /tmp/dbus.log - Try to change your status using gnome-shell - Once it fails attach /tmp/dbus.log
Created attachment 213565 [details] dbus.log here you are
Hum I don't see anything about your ICQ account in this log. Was it connected when you tried disconnecting? What's the output of 'mc-tool list' ?
Yes. It was online before I go offline from gnome-shell menu and after icq was online. mc-tool list. Where I can find it?
Created attachment 213566 [details] script Could you please download this small script and do the following: - Make sure all your accounts are online, especially the ICQ one - dbus-monitor > /tmp/dbus.log - python presence.py offline - Wait a few seconds - python presence.py - Stop dbus-monitor and attach it to this bug. Attach the output of presence.py as well
Created attachment 213569 [details] dbus.log here
presence.py output john~$ python presence.py offline account gabble/jabber/goa_google_account_1335582213: (2, available, ) account gabble/jabber/id172441936_40vk_2ecom0: (2, available, ) account haze/icq/_34252665850: (2, available, ) account gabble/jabber/kacenkov_40jabber_2eru0: (2, available, ) Change presence to offline john~$ python presence.py account gabble/jabber/goa_google_account_1335582213: (1, offline, ) account gabble/jabber/id172441936_40vk_2ecom0: (1, offline, ) account haze/icq/_34252665850: (1, offline, ) account gabble/jabber/kacenkov_40jabber_2eru0: (1, offline, ) john~$
Looks like the ICQ account has been disconnected, didn't it?
yep, this script affect icq accaunt too. i can set online and offline status typing python presence.py offline python presence.py online
I noticed interesting thing Incorrect behavior only after login, but if run 'gnome-shell --replace' after it I can change the status from gmone-shell status-menu
i have same issue. nothing helped for me. i am using Fedora 17 32bit with Gnome 3.4.2 and Empathy 3.4.2.1 really want fix this issue :(
Same thing on Gentoo with GNOME 3.6.2. I have several accounts (people nearby, gtalk, icq), people nearby and gtalk are affected by the changes made in status menu, but icq account only changes when status is selected from empathy itself. Disabling google chat in Online accounts does not interfere with the described issue, so I guess it's not a somewhat magic combination of accounts. Please ask me if any information or command output is needed for investigation.
-- GitLab Migration Automatic Message -- This bug has been migrated to GNOME's GitLab instance and has been closed from further activity. You can subscribe and participate further through the new bug through this link to our GitLab instance: https://gitlab.gnome.org/GNOME/empathy/issues/536.